Как правильно использовать jQuery .sap.log.debug вместо console.log в SAPUI5 v.1.38.39? - PullRequest
1 голос
/ 29 января 2020

Об окружающей среде:

  • Используемая среда: SAPUI5
  • версия: 1.38.39
  • разработка среда: sap web-ide
  • Воспроизводится с помощью OpenUI5 v.1.38

О проблеме:

Рекомендация из UI5: для не используйте консоль. log ("message")
Предложение из UI5: использовать jQuery .sap.log.debug ("message") вместо документации здесь
ожидаемый результат: см. "сообщение" в консоли от chrome отладчик "
фактический результат: Не вижу" сообщения " в консоли"

Кодовая часть:

на моем контроллере:

onInit: function(){
  jQuery.sap.log.debug('onInit fired'); // display nothing in chrome console
  console.log('onInit fired'); // display "onInit fired" in chrome console
},

Вопрос:

Есть ли у кого-нибудь решение или идея для решения этой проблемы ?

Замечание:

  1. Мой вопрос , вероятно, простой , но я не нашел никакого решения нигде , и я новичок в UI5, поэтому я прошу здесь, спасибо за вашу помощь * 10 53 * и понимание .
  2. Если кто-то также может сказать мне, почему этот вопрос (единственный, который я задал до сих пор) блокирует меня, чтобы задавать дополнительные вопросы, я думаю, что сообщение уважают это ? Спасибо за ваш отзыв

1 Ответ

1 голос
/ 29 января 2020

Вы установили уровень журнала на DEBUG?
Если не пытаетесь добавить:

jQuery.sap.log.setLevel(jQuery.sap.log.Level.DEBUG)

Кроме того, есть ли какая-то конкретная причина, по которой вы используете 1,38, а не что-то более новое?

...